Mastering AI Systems: From Notion to Execution

Successfully navigating the journey of AI adoption requires more than just a brilliant idea; it demands a structured approach to building robust and efficient workflows. This involves carefully transitioning from that initial thought – perhaps identifying a problem needing automation or a new opportunity ripe for exploration – to a fully operational execution. A critical early stage includes defining the specific goals and objectives, ensuring alignment with business strategies, and establishing clear metrics for success. Then comes data preparation: gathering, cleaning, and labeling the necessary datasets, frequently the most time-consuming aspect of any AI project. Next, selecting the appropriate model or algorithm – whether it's a pre-trained solution or requires bespoke creation - is paramount. Furthermore, diligent testing, validation, read more and iterative refinement are essential to guarantee accuracy, reliability, and fairness in your final AI system. Finally, ongoing monitoring and maintenance are vital; the performance of an AI model often degrades over time, requiring regular retraining and adjustments to maintain optimal output.

AI Workflow Creation: Best Practices and Common Pitfalls

Crafting efficient AI processes demands careful consideration. Begin by clearly defining the goal; a vague purpose often leads to troublesome and ineffective outcomes. It's essential to map out each step, identifying data sources, necessary transformations, and appropriate AI models—assessing their strengths and limitations. A key best practice is modularity; break down the workflow into smaller, manageable components that can be independently tested and leveraged. This facilitates debugging and promotes flexibility for future updates or changes to the AI system. However, common pitfalls include neglecting data quality – "garbage in, garbage out" remains a significant challenge; overlooking potential biases within datasets leading to unfair or inaccurate predictions; and failing to account for real-world variability resulting performance degradation over time. Furthermore, insufficient monitoring and logging can hinder troubleshooting and prevent proactive adjustments to the system's function. Finally, forgetting to document your workflow fully makes maintenance a nightmare for yourself or future collaborators.

  • Prioritize data quality at every juncture.
  • Ensure thorough testing of all workflow components.
  • Regularly audit and address biases in datasets.
  • Implement robust monitoring and logging mechanisms.
  • Maintain comprehensive documentation for long-term usability.
